== Old English == === Etymology === From Tīna (“River Tyne”) +‎ mūþ (“mouth”) === Proper noun === Tinanmuþ m Tynemouth (a town in the Metropolitan Borough of North Tyneside, Tyne and Wear, England), formerly in Northumbria The Anglo-Saxon Chronicle ==== Declension ==== Strong a-stem:
